Quick Observation
~15cm of fresh snow rests on the crust from the atmospheric river and is currently being redistributed by moderate east winds, creating isolated pockets of wind slab on lee features. This slab was observed sitting on several cm of low density snow above the crust rather than failing directly on the crust. Hoping to ski mellow open slopes to avoid hitting the crust too much, fog forced us to search for the larches. Snow was less wind affected in the 5 Mile fingers, but look out for frozen chunks beneath the new snow.
